Joey Logano to fill in for Hailie Deegan in Chicago

STATESVILLE, N.C. — AM Racing confirmed Monday that Joey Logano will fill in for Hailie Deegan during this Saturday’s NASCAR Xfinity Series race in Chicago.

“It is our goal at AM Racing to field a competitive race team through our technical alliance with Stewart-Haas Racing and provide any of our drivers the best equipment and opportunity to be successful on track each weekend,” said Wade Moore, the president of AM Racing, in a news release issued Monday. “With that being said, we haven’t had the success on track that we were hoping for in the first half of the season.”

Deegan sits 27th in points, the lowest of any driver who has started all 17 races this season. She has just seven finishes of 25th or better and no finish better than 12th (at Talladega) this season.

“When the opportunity to have Joey [Logano] in the car at Chicago became a possibility, we felt we needed to take advantage of the knowledge and feedback that a two-time NASCAR Cup Series Champion could provide to our teams’ growth,” Moore said.

Team partner Klutch Vodka will adorn their colors on Logano’s car in The Loop 110. The race will mark Logano’s first Xfinity Series start since Bristol in August 2019.

“Racing in the rain on Chicago’s Street Course last year was a challenge within itself. Any extra seat time is always a positive for unique tracks such as this one. Driving the NASCAR Xfinity Series cars is a lot of fun. And I’m looking forward to climbing behind the wheel with high hopes to wheel it to the front,” Logano said.

Last year, AM Racing finished fourth in the race with Brett Moffitt.
